Bulgaria is ready to share experience and good practices in the field of security with Ghana, as transpired at a meeting between Bulgarian Prime Minister Nikolay Denkov and Ghanaian Minister of National Security Albert Kan-Dapaah, the Council of Ministers said on Facebook Tuesday. Kan-Dapaah is visiting Sofia at the invitation of Interior Minister Kalin Stoyanov.
The purpose of the visit is to exchange views and discuss joint initiatives in security and other fields of mutual interest.
At the meeting, Denkov pointed out that relations with Africa are becoming increasingly important for the EU in strategic terms. In this respect, the Prime Minister highlighted Bulgaria’s active role in shaping the EU's Common Foreign and Security Policy regarding Africa.
Denkov reiterated this country's commitment to Ghana's security, including at the European level.
